Output 5e274829b21b9a6013c5cc87516dd05929faa3ee52392843ae46c1321d37da99:2

value
681497
script pubkey
OP_0 OP_PUSHBYTES_20 50ab2e18d2aa45b20117f05fce57fd07b498545e
address
bc1q2z4juxxj4fzmyqgh7p0uu4laq76fs4z7z830z9
transaction
5e274829b21b9a6013c5cc87516dd05929faa3ee52392843ae46c1321d37da99
confirmations
209733
spent
true